Robert S. Glass, O.d. A Professional Corporation is a Optometrist based in Costa Mesa, CA. Robert S. Glass, O.d. A Professional Corporation practices in Costa Mesa, CA. The NPI Number for Robert S. Glass, O.d. A Professional Corporation is 1336416577 and holds a License No. 6447T (California).
The current practice location address for Robert S. Glass, O.d. A Professional Corporation is 1696 Newport Blvd, Costa Mesa, CA and can be reached out via phone at 949-547-0200.
Use the following badge on your website to showcase your NPI number and verified status. In a field with over 8 million healthcare providers in the United States, it is important to establish your identity clearly. Displaying this badge signifies that your information is both accurate and up-to-date.